Output efea2bc30abdc0370106dfa7c7ee40e38bf50d228ea2037ece519ed1dda80521:0

value
16020704
script pubkey
OP_0 OP_PUSHBYTES_20 feec66818d280edd158b968ae66463bea1fd5182
address
bc1qlmkxdqvd9q8d69vtj69wverrh6sl65vzke975a
transaction
efea2bc30abdc0370106dfa7c7ee40e38bf50d228ea2037ece519ed1dda80521
confirmations
23713
spent
true